RT Journal Article SR Electronic T1 Macroamylasemia: A Simple Stepwise Approach To Diagnosis JF The Journal of the American Board of Family Practice JO J Am Board Fam Med FD American Board of Family Medicine SP 279 OP 282 DO 10.3122/jabfm.2.4.279 VO 2 IS 4 A1 LeVine, David A1 Parrish, David YR 1989 UL http://www.jabfm.org/content/2/4/279.abstract AB Typically, macroamylasemia is a condition of elevated serum amylase in the absence of symptomatic disease. However, in the presence of symptoms, especially of abdominal origin, it is important that this condition be identified accurately in order to avoid unnecessary treatment for pancreatitis or other related diseases. This report offers a review of the literature, a case example, and an algorithm for systematically considering the diagnosis of macroamylasemia.
